The Health Benefits of E-Cigaretta Usage
One of the primary appeals of adopting an e-cigaretta lies in its reduced harm compared to traditional tobacco products. Unlike combustible cigarettes, which generate tar and many toxic chemicals, e-cigarettes deliver nicotine via aerosolized liquid without combustion. Numerous scientific studies indicate that switching from traditional smoking to vaping can substantially reduce exposure to carcinogens and harmful substances.
Additionally, users often report improved respiratory symptoms and better physical fitness after transitioning to e-cigaretta
, highlighting a tangible enhancement in quality of life. The flexibility of e-liquid flavors and nicotine concentrations also allows users to customize their experience and gradually reduce nicotine intake—a strategic advantage for cessation efforts.
Addressing the Concern: Are E-Cigarette Vapour Emissions Harmful to Others?
Secondhand smoke from traditional cigarettes has long been recognized as a health risk, prompting inquiries into whether e-cigarette vapour poses similar dangers. Scientific consensus generally characterizes secondhand aerosol from e-cigaretta as significantly less harmful than tobacco smoke. The vapour primarily consists of water, propylene glycol, glycerin, nicotine in varying amounts, and trace levels of other compounds.
However, it’s important to note that non-smokers, especially vulnerable populations such as children, pregnant women, and individuals with respiratory conditions, may still be sensitive to e-cigarette vapour. While the e-cigaretta
vapour dissipates quickly and does not contain the same carcinogenic load as cigarette smoke, inhaling secondhand aerosol may expose bystanders to nicotine and ultrafine particles that could have mild short-term irritant effects.
Scientific Studies and Public Health Recommendations
Multiple analytical assessments have measured the chemical constituents in e-cigarette vapour and found that the concentrations of harmful compounds are generally orders of magnitude lower compared to cigarette smoke. Nonetheless, public health authorities emphasize caution, encouraging users to vape in designated areas and avoid exposing nonsmokers to any aerosol.
Educational campaigns often promote awareness about vaping etiquette and highlight the ongoing evaluation of long-term impact, as the evidence is still evolving. Regulatory frameworks worldwide are being updated to include restrictions on indoor vaping, reflecting caution in the face of incomplete data on passive exposure effects.
Practical Advice for Vapers and Bystanders
For those who choose to use e-cigaretta, responsible use is critical. This includes avoiding vaping around nonsmokers, maintaining clean and well-ventilated environments, and using quality-controlled devices and e-liquids to minimize potential risks. For bystanders concerned about passive exposure, maintaining distance from active vaping zones and ensuring adequate air circulation can reduce any possible effects.

Frequently Asked Questions About E-Cigaretta and Vapour Exposure
- Is secondhand e-cigarette vapour dangerous?
- Current studies indicate that secondhand vapour contains significantly fewer harmful chemicals than tobacco smoke, but it is best to avoid prolonged exposure, especially for vulnerable groups.
- Can e-cigaretta help smokers quit?
- Many users find vaping a useful tool to reduce or quit traditional smoking, thanks to customizable nicotine levels and less harsh effects.
- Are there regulations protecting non-vapers from exposure?
- Yes, numerous countries have enacted policies restricting vaping in public indoor spaces to protect nonsmokers from passive aerosol exposure.
- What are the common chemicals in e-cigarette vapour?
- The vapour mainly contains nicotine, propylene glycol, glycerin, and flavorings, with trace amounts of other substances generally considered less toxic than cigarette smoke.
